Vulnerability Name:

CVE-2007-6439 (CCN-39180)

Assigned:2007-12-18
Published:2007-12-18
Updated:2023-02-13
Summary:Wireshark (formerly Ethereal) 0.99.6 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(infinite or large loop) via the (1) IPv6 or (2) USB dissector, which can trigger resource consumption or a crash.
Note: this identifier originally included Firebird/Interbase, but it is already covered by CVE-2007-6116. The DCP ETSI issue is already covered by CVE-2007-6119.
